摘要 |
An information processing apparatus (1) which estimates a three-dimensional position-and-orientation of a measuring object (50) using an imaging apparatus (20;30) capable of capturing a two-dimensional image and a range image, includes a data storing unit (110) configured to store verification data for estimating a position-and-orientation of a measuring object, a two-dimensional image input unit (120) configured to input a two-dimensional image captured by the imaging apparatus (20;30) in a first position-and-orientation, a range image input unit (130) configured to input a range image captured by the imaging apparatus (20;30) in a second position-and-orientation, a position-and-orientation information input unit (150) configured to acquire position-and-orientation difference information which is relative position-and-orientation information in the first position-and-orientation and the second position-and-orientation, and a calculation unit (160) configured to calculate, based on the position-and-orientation difference information, a position-and-orientation of the measuring object so that the verification data for estimating the position-and-orientation matches the two-dimensional image and the range image. |